BLM AND WITS RURAL KNOWLEDGE HUB HOSTED SCIENCE AND SERVICE DELIVERY SYMPOSIUM
Bushbuckridge Local Municipality (BLM), in collaboration with the Wits Rural Knowledge Hub, hosted a Science and Service Delivery Symposium on 4 November 2025 at the Wits Rural Campus on Orpen Road. The symposium focused on strengthening research and development to enhance service delivery, particularly in support of BLM’s Rural Metro initiative.

The symposium addressed four key service delivery areas: municipal research strategies, planning and economic development, water and natural resource management, and waste management. Research findings revealed widespread illegal dumping, particularly of diapers, including dumping in streams used for domestic water, posing serious environmental and health risks.
Delegates agreed that follow-up sessions were necessary to monitor progress and address challenges promptly.
